On Windows 7 sp1, 64-bit en-US with these test documents

https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/attachment.cgi?id=112456
https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/attachment.cgi?id=113167

Confirm Shift+F5 is not functioning with

Version: 4.4.2.2
Build ID: c4c7d32d0d49397cad38d62472b0bc8acff48dd6
Locale: en_US

but it does work correctly same system with

Version: 4.5.0.0.alpha0+
Build ID: 3c6fd5a59b08cec8705a31d17a60204acf6b7173
TinderBox: Win-x86@62-TDF, Branch:MASTER, Time: 2015-03-29_02:04:01
Locale: en_US

Note the same behavior, i.e. 4.4.2.2 broken, 4.5.0.0alpha0+ works, with these
32-bit builds for issue of opening to last edited position when user data
details (first/last/initials) are filled in, bug 80960

Have to bisect a bit but suspect Kendy's commit for bug 80960

http://cgit.freedesktop.org/libreoffice/core/commit/?id=c99e634e06aa97d9230d9200206e9c2e8e373ed0

did some good here.

Also, for 64-bit Windows builds on same system Shift+F5 function is mostly
correct--except for issues of bug 51217 bug 62398, where the cursor placement
can be off by a dozen characters.

Version: 4.5.0.0.alpha0+ (x64)
Build ID: 48916c9b8c1363a37bf511626326ee6dc150975c
TinderBox: Win-x86_64@42, Branch:master, Time: 2015-03-17_22:56:52
Locale: en_US

and with (first/last/initials set) it opens vicinity of last edited position.
